- The distance between Teresina, Brazil and Dawson Creek, Bc, Canada is approximately 9,692 km or 6,023 mi.
- To reach Teresina in this distance one would set out from Dawson Creek, Bc bearing 103.3° or ESE and follow the great circles arc to approach Teresina bearing 146.6° or SSE .
- Teresina has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w) whereas Dawson Creek, Bc has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c).
- Teresina is in or near the tropical dry forest biome whereas Dawson Creek, Bc is in or near the boreal moist forest biome.
- The average temperature is 25.1 °C (45.2°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 24.6 °C (44.3°F) less in Teresina.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 961.1 mm (37.8 in) more which is equivalent to 961.1 l/m² (23.59 US gal/ft²) or 9,611,000 l/ha (1,027,480 US gal/ac) more. About 3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 39.8° higher in Teresina than in Dawson Creek, Bc.
